Hundreds of arts and culture jobs in New York listed on website


NEW YORK (PIX11) – Are you passionate about the arts and looking for a job? 

The New York Foundation for the Arts bills itself as the ‘go-to jobs board in the arts and culture industry.’ It lists hundreds of job opportunities for individuals living in the New York region. 

“ Established in 1971, the mission of the New York Foundation for the Arts (NYFA) is to empower artists in all disciplines, as well as cultural workers, to achieve success on their own terms by providing critical support, resources, and opportunities,” reads the website. 

This website currently lists multiple positions for all members of the art community in need of work, ranging from art handlers to publicists to gallery managers. 

Currently, the website lists jobs at famous New York City institutions like the Museum of Modern Art, which seeks a senior publicist with a salary of $85,917, according to the site. 

Another renowned institution, Lincoln Center Theatre, has an Associate Director of Marketing position available, with a starting salary of $90,000. 

The renowned art school, Juilliard, is in need of an Artistic Administrator, which lists the starting salary as $68,000, according to the site.
